Why Commercial Security Is More Important Than Ever in 2026
Commercial properties experience constant movement throughout the day. Employees enter and exit repeatedly, deliveries arrive continuously, customers use front entrances nonstop, and service providers require temporary access.
Every opening and closing cycle creates wear on: • Lock cylinders
• Hinges
• Door closers
• Panic hardware
• Strike plates
• Commercial frames
Many businesses unknowingly rely on outdated or residential-grade hardware that simply cannot withstand heavy daily usage.
The Problem with Standard Locks in Commercial Buildings
A residential lock installed in a commercial setting usually fails prematurely because it was never engineered for high-volume traffic.
For example:
| Hardware Type | Average Cycle Rating |
|---|---|
| Residential-grade lock | 20,000–40,000 cycles |
| ANSI Grade 1 commercial hardware | 1,000,000+ cycles |
If your storefront door opens 200 times daily, that equals more than 50,000 cycles per year. That means low-grade hardware may begin failing within months. This is why professional commercial lock installation matters.

High-Security Lock Systems Are the Future of Commercial Protection
One of the biggest commercial security trends in 2026 is the widespread shift toward high-security lock systems.
Traditional locks can often be:
• Picked
• Bumped
• Drilled
• Copied without authorization
Modern high-security cylinders are engineered specifically to prevent these vulnerabilities.
We install advanced systems from trusted security manufacturers including:
• Medeco
• Mul-T-Lock
Benefits of High-Security Commercial Locks
Restricted Key Duplication
Unauthorized employees cannot secretly duplicate keys at hardware stores or kiosks.
Drill Resistance
Hardened steel inserts protect against forced drilling attacks.
Pick Resistance
Advanced internal pin systems make traditional lock picking extremely difficult.
Better Key Control
Only approved individuals can authorize additional keys.
For businesses handling:
• Financial records
• Pharmaceuticals
• High-value inventory
• Sensitive customer information
high-security systems are essential for risk reduction.
Master Key Systems Simplify Commercial Access
Many property managers struggle with excessive key management.
Without a structured access system:
• Employees carry too many keys
• Maintenance becomes inefficient
• Security oversight weakens
• Rekeying costs increase
We design hierarchical master key systems that improve operational efficiency while maintaining strong access control.
How a Master Key System Works
| Access Level | Function |
|---|---|
| Grand Master Key | Opens entire facility |
| Sub-Master Key | Opens designated zones |
| Employee Key | Opens only assigned areas |

Commercial Door Repair Is Often More Important Than the Lock
Many lock problems are actually structural door problems.
If a door:
• drags,
• sags,
• sticks,
• shifts,
• or fails to latch,
the lock cannot function correctly.
Structural Issues We Commonly Repair
Sagging Commercial Doors
Heavy-use doors gradually drop out of alignment over time.
Steel Frame Damage
Older Yonkers buildings often develop frame shifting or rust.
Hinge Failures
Worn hinges place stress on locks and closers.
Door Closer Malfunctions
A door that does not close fully cannot secure properly.

Why “Single Motion Egress” Matters
Fire codes require building occupants to exit quickly during emergencies. Panic hardware allows immediate exit with one push motion without requiring a key or complicated unlocking process.

Commercial Security Tips for Yonkers Businesses
Use these expert recommendations to strengthen your property protection:
Replace outdated lock cylinders
Older hardware is easier to bypass.
Audit employee key access regularly
Former employees should never retain active access.
Test panic hardware monthly
Exit systems must work reliably during emergencies.
Inspect door closers every six months
Leaking closers often fail unexpectedly.
Upgrade to restricted key systems
This prevents unauthorized duplication.
Schedule annual commercial security inspections
Small hardware problems often become major vulnerabilities later.
